Advantages of a Data Room

A data room can be an environment that is secure for business team members to store and share documents. It is especially beneficial for businesses that deal with sensitive materials. For instance, it can to prevent employees from accidentally sharing sensitive information via unsecure digital file-sharing platforms. It allows companies to control the access to certain files. For instance, a business might decide to hide certain information from investors until it is further along in its fundraising campaign.

Traditionally, a data room was a physical space in a business’s office, a lawyer’s office or some other secure space where documents could be accessed only by those who had access. The data room was usually physically monitored and secured. Nowadays, most companies prefer virtual data rooms since they are more convenient and secure.

A virtual data room is accessible on any device with an internet connection. It lets team members work from home or on the move, and can save time since there is no requirement to send documents via postal mail or photocopy documents. It is also more efficient, since the search feature of the software is able to quickly find specific information.

In addition, many modern data rooms come with advanced security features that are not available on traditional file-sharing platforms. Many digital data rooms, for example provide strong encryption both in transit and while the files are at rest. This stops hackers from getting access to private information, even if they gain access to them. Furthermore, many platforms allow administrators to customize the watermarks on each document page, which will prevent unauthorised users from sharing files without authorization. Some platforms also provide remote shred that automatically deletes all data whenever an administrator denies the permission of a user.
